MALICIOUS MISCHIEF (noun)


Sense 1malicious mischief [BACK TO TOP]

Meaning:

Willful wanton and malicious destruction of the property of others

Classified under:

Nouns denoting acts or actions

Synonyms:

hooliganism; malicious mischief; vandalism

Hypernyms ("malicious mischief" is a kind of...):

destruction; devastation (the termination of something by causing so much damage to it that it cannot be repaired or no longer exists)

devilment; devilry; deviltry; mischief; mischief-making; mischievousness; rascality; roguery; roguishness; shenanigan (reckless or malicious behavior that causes discomfort or annoyance in others)
